## Reported LIBERO results
|
| 93 |
-
|
| 94 |
-
Across the four released suite checkpoints, WorldDiT records 1,898 successful
|
| 95 |
-
episodes out of 2,000 under the selection aware evaluation protocol.
|
| 96 |
-
|
| 97 |
-
| Suite | Successful episodes | Success rate |
|
| 98 |
-
|---|---:|---:|
|
| 99 |
-
| LIBERO Spatial | 490 of 500 | 98.0 percent |
|
| 100 |
-
| LIBERO Object | 485 of 500 | 97.0 percent |
|
| 101 |
-
| LIBERO Goal | 464 of 500 | 92.8 percent |
|
| 102 |
-
| LIBERO Long | 459 of 500 | 91.8 percent |
|
| 103 |
-
| Selection aware mean | 1,898 of 2,000 | 94.9 percent |

The released runtime and checkpoints were revalidated from a clean installation
|
| 113 |
+
on eight RTX Pro 6000 Blackwell GPUs. The result is selection aware because
|
| 114 |
+
three hundred episodes per suite informed staged checkpoint selection before
|
| 115 |
+
the final five hundred episode score was assembled.

## Use and scope
|
| 275 |
|
| 276 |
+
| Intended use | Scope of the release |
|
| 277 |
+
|---|---|
|
| 278 |
+
| Research on language conditioned robot manipulation in the LIBERO simulator. The released checkpoints support reproduction, evaluation, and architecture research across the four released suites. | The results describe LIBERO simulation under the released evaluation protocol. They do not establish real robot reliability, safety, or transfer across embodiments. |
|
| 279 |
+
| The released checkpoints cover all four LIBERO suites. | The release does not isolate the causal contribution of the future visual target. Total parameter count does not measure training cost, deployment latency, or runtime efficiency. |
